- #include <unistd.h>
- #include <stdio.h>
- #include <drivers/dev_pwm.h>
- #include "drv_pwm.h"
- #include "drv_pinctrl.h"
- #include <rtdbg.h>
- #include "utest.h"
- /*
- * 测试 PWM 驱动对板载 LED 的亮度控制功能
- *
- * 1. 查找名为 "pwm" 的 PWM 设备。
- * 2. 使用 pinctrl 将 GPIO52 映射为 PWM4 通道,并配置引脚属性:
- * - 使能输出(OE);
- * - 禁用输入(IE);
- * - 禁用上下拉(PU/PD);
- * - 设置中等驱动能力(驱动强度为 4)。
- * 3. 设置 PWM 输出周期为 100000ns(对应频率为 10kHz)。
- * 4. 通过逐步增加 PWM 的脉冲宽度(pulse),控制板载 LED 的亮度由暗到亮:
- * - 从 10% 占空比(10000ns)开始;
- * - 每次增加 10%,直到 100%(全亮);
- * - 每次间隔 2 秒以便观察 LED 亮度变化。
- * 5. 最后禁用 PWM 输出,关闭 LED。
- *
- * 硬件说明:
- * - 本测试基于 K230-01studio 开发板;
- * - GPIO52 已通过电路连接一颗板载 LED;
- * - PWM4 通道控制该 LED 的亮灭和亮度;
- * - 测试过程中,可肉眼观察 LED 明暗变化。
- *
- */
- #define PWM_DEV_NAME "pwm1" /* PWM设备名称 */
- #define PWM_DEV_CHANNEL 1 /* PWM通道 */
- #define TEST_GPIO_LED 52
- void pwm_demo(void)
- {
- LOG_I("set gpio52 in PWM1 start.\n");
- k230_pinctrl_set_function(TEST_GPIO_LED, IOMUX_FUNC3);
- /* 使能输出 */
- k230_pinctrl_set_oe(TEST_GPIO_LED, 1);
- /* 禁止输入 */
- k230_pinctrl_set_ie(TEST_GPIO_LED, 0);
- /* 禁止上拉 */
- k230_pinctrl_set_pu(TEST_GPIO_LED, 0);
- /* 禁止下拉 */
- k230_pinctrl_set_pd(TEST_GPIO_LED, 0);
- /* 设置驱动能力为4(中等强度) */
- k230_pinctrl_set_drv(TEST_GPIO_LED, 4);
- LOG_I("pwm test start.\n");
- struct rt_device_pwm *pwm_dev; /* PWM设备句柄 */
- rt_uint32_t period; /* 周期, 单位为纳秒ns */
- rt_uint32_t pulse; /* PWM脉冲宽度值, 单位为纳秒ns */
- rt_err_t ret;
- /* 查找设备 */
- pwm_dev = (struct rt_device_pwm *)rt_device_find(PWM_DEV_NAME);
- uassert_not_null(pwm_dev);
- /* 设置PWM周期和脉冲宽度 */
- period = 100000; /* PWM 周期:100000ns = 100us,即 10kHz */
- /* 逐步循环提高PWM脉冲宽度 */
- for(pulse = 10000; pulse <= 100000; pulse+=10000)
- {
- ret = rt_pwm_set(pwm_dev, PWM_DEV_CHANNEL, period, pulse);
- uassert_int_equal(ret, RT_EOK);
- ret = rt_pwm_enable(pwm_dev, PWM_DEV_CHANNEL);
- uassert_int_equal(ret, RT_EOK);
- sleep(2);
- }
- ret = rt_pwm_disable(pwm_dev, PWM_DEV_CHANNEL);
- uassert_int_equal(ret, RT_EOK);
- }
- static void pwm_testcase(void)
- {
- UTEST_UNIT_RUN(pwm_demo);
- }
- static rt_err_t utest_tc_init(void)
- {
- return RT_EOK;
- }
- static rt_err_t utest_tc_cleanup(void)
- {
- return RT_EOK;
- }
- UTEST_TC_EXPORT(pwm_testcase, "bsp.k230.drivers.pwm", utest_tc_init, utest_tc_cleanup, 10);
